1972-D Doubled Die Reverse WDDR-001
ErrorDescription
First doubled die reverse cataloged for the 1972-D Jefferson Nickel, this variety was discovered by Whaden Curtis. It exhibits Class II Distorted Hub Doubling with nice spread on E PLURIBUS UNUM, increasing from left to right across the motto. This graduated intensity is characteristic of Class II displacement, where rotational distortion during hubbing concentrates doubling more strongly toward one side of the die face. A die dot inside the large center semicircular window of Monticello serves as the primary reverse die marker, providing a precise attribution point within the building's most prominent architectural feature. As the inaugural DDR entry for 1972-D, WDDR-001 establishes the baseline for the doubled die reverse census on this Denver Mint date. The 1972-D Jefferson Nickel was produced during a period of high-volume coining, and Curtis's discovery opened the door for subsequent researchers to examine the production run for additional hub displacement events. Cross-referenced as Wexler Variety ID 1972-D WDDR-001. Die Markers: Obverse: Short vertical die gouge near right edge of U of TRUST; die gouge to left of I of IN.
